Using your understanding of the Latin prefix di-/dis-, choose the correct meaning of disassociate.
A.

to separate from
B.

to forget completely
C.

to learn more about
D.

to bring together

All Answers 1

Answered by GPT-5 mini AI
A — to separate from.
The prefix dis-/di- means "apart" or "away," so disassociate means to remove or separate an association.
